excel怎么拟合多指数方程

excel怎么拟合多指数方程

在Excel中拟合多指数方程的方法包括使用Excel内置的工具和函数,如数据分析工具、Solver插件、指数回归公式等。其中,使用Solver插件进行非线性回归拟合是一种常见且有效的方法。下面我将详细介绍如何在Excel中使用这些工具和步骤来实现多指数方程的拟合。


一、准备数据

在进行多指数方程拟合之前,首先需要准备好数据。假设你的数据如下:

x y
1 2.5
2 3.8
3 5.1
4 6.5
5 7.8

在Excel中输入这些数据,并将其放在合适的单元格范围内。

二、拟合多指数方程的数学模型

多指数方程通常表示为以下形式:

[ y = a_1 cdot e^{b_1 cdot x} + a_2 cdot e^{b_2 cdot x} + ldots + a_n cdot e^{b_n cdot x} ]

其中,( a_1, a_2, ldots, a_n ) 和 ( b_1, b_2, ldots, b_n ) 是需要拟合的参数。

三、使用Excel公式进行初步拟合

1. 创建初始参数

在Excel表格中,为每个参数创建单元格。例如:

参数 初始值
a1 1
b1 0.1
a2 1
b2 0.1

这些初始值可以根据经验或猜测设定。

2. 计算拟合值

在数据表的旁边,创建一个新的列来计算每个x对应的拟合y值。假设你将初始参数a1, b1, a2, b2分别放在单元格D2, E2, F2, G2中,那么可以在H2中输入以下公式来计算拟合值:

[ =$D$2EXP($E$2A2)+$F$2EXP($G$2A2) ]

将公式向下复制,计算所有x对应的拟合y值。

3. 计算误差

在数据表的另一列中计算实际y值与拟合y值之间的误差平方和。假设拟合y值在H列,那么在I2中输入以下公式:

[ =(B2-H2)^2 ]

将公式向下复制,计算所有误差平方和。

4. 总误差平方和

在数据表的底部,计算总误差平方和。在I列的最后一个单元格中输入以下公式:

[ =SUM(I2:I6) ]

四、使用Solver插件进行优化

1. 启用Solver插件

如果Solver插件尚未启用,可以通过以下步骤启用:

  1. 点击“文件”菜单,选择“选项”。
  2. 在Excel选项对话框中,选择“加载项”。
  3. 在“管理”下拉菜单中选择“Excel加载项”,点击“转到”。
  4. 勾选“Solver加载项”,点击“确定”。

2. 设置Solver参数

  1. 打开Solver插件(点击“数据”选项卡,然后点击“Solver”)。
  2. 在“设置目标单元格”中,选择总误差平方和单元格(例如I7)。
  3. 选择“等于”并设置为最小值。
  4. 在“可变单元格”中,选择初始参数单元格(例如D2:G2)。
  5. 添加约束条件(例如,确保a1, a2, b1, b2均为正值)。
  6. 点击“求解”按钮,Solver会自动调整参数以最小化误差平方和。

五、验证拟合结果

1. 观察拟合曲线

将拟合的y值与实际y值绘制在同一个图表中,观察拟合曲线与实际数据的吻合程度。如果拟合效果不佳,可以尝试调整初始参数或增加更多的指数项。

2. 统计指标

计算R平方值或其他统计指标,评估拟合模型的优劣。R平方值越接近1,说明拟合效果越好。

六、总结与优化建议

1. 反复优化

通过反复调整初始参数和重新运行Solver,可以不断优化拟合结果。在某些情况下,增加更多的指数项可能会提高拟合精度。

2. 其他工具和方法

除了Excel,还可以使用其他专业的数据分析工具(如Matlab、Python的SciPy库等)来进行多指数方程的拟合。这些工具通常提供更强大的功能和更高的计算效率。

3. 实际应用

多指数方程拟合在许多领域具有广泛的应用,如生物学、化学、经济学等。在实际应用中,选择合适的模型和工具,结合专业知识进行分析和优化,能够有效提高数据分析的准确性和可靠性。


通过以上步骤,可以在Excel中成功拟合多指数方程。需要注意的是,拟合结果的准确性依赖于数据的质量和初始参数的选择。因此,在实际操作中,建议结合具体情况进行调整和优化,以获得最佳的拟合效果。

相关问答FAQs:

1. 什么是多指数方程拟合?
多指数方程拟合是指通过使用Excel的拟合功能,将一组数据拟合为多项式方程。这种方法可以用来预测未来的趋势和模式。

2. 如何在Excel中进行多指数方程拟合?
在Excel中进行多指数方程拟合,可以按照以下步骤操作:

  • 将要拟合的数据输入到Excel的工作表中。
  • 在工作表中选择一个空白的单元格,然后点击"插入"选项卡上的"函数"按钮。
  • 在函数对话框中,选择"拟合"函数,然后按照指导进行参数设置。
  • 在函数对话框中选择要拟合的数据范围,并选择多项式的阶数。
  • 点击"确定"按钮,Excel将自动计算出拟合的多项式方程。

3. 如何解读多指数方程拟合的结果?
多指数方程拟合的结果将会显示拟合的多项式方程的系数。这些系数表示了每个指数项的权重和影响力。通过分析这些系数,可以判断数据的趋势和模式。一般来说,系数越大,该指数项对数据的影响越大;系数越小,该指数项对数据的影响越小。同时,还可以通过观察拟合曲线的形状和趋势,来进一步解读多指数方程拟合的结果。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4293832

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部